One Injured in Early Morning Crash in Attala on New Year’s Day

SHARE NOW

Attala County deputies, Mississippi Highway Patrol, and EMS responded to a single-vehicle crash around 4:15 a.m. Thursday, Jan. 1, near the intersection of Highway 14 and Highway 43 South.

Just before the wreck was reported, a caller contacted authorities stating someone had knocked on their door twice and requested deputies check the area for a possible prowler.

Responding deputies later determined the individual was the driver of the overturned vehicle, who had gone to nearby homes seeking help after the crash.

The driver was found outside the vehicle and attempting to flag down motorists.

The driver complained of back pain and was transported by EMS to Baptist Attala for treatment. Mississippi Highway Patrol worked the crash.
